Tired of Hearing Helicopter Noise? (UPDATED)

 

This information was found in the same HUNC newsletter. We have corrected the phone number error by visiting the website. Please file complaints! 

 

Every resident in Los Angeles County can now report helicopter noise on the Federal Aviation Administration's new automated Helicopter Noise Complaint System.  We can stop helicopter noise - if we ALL report those low flying, hovering, or noisy helicopters.

 

The system is easy to use - with three ways to report noise complaints:
1.  Call 424-348-4354 (that's 424-348-HELI) and follow the voice prompts
2.  Use the General Complaint Form at http://heli-noise-la.com/how-to-use/
3.  Track and complain about a specific helicopter at http://heli-noise-la.com/webtrak/

 

The Federal Aviation Administration funded development of the complaint system and is funding its initial operation from April 2015 through March 2016.  So, please use this system every time you are bothered by helicopter noise.  Let the FAA know it is important to you.

This is a unique opportunity to have your voices heard.  Send the attached flyer to your friends and neighbors - remind them to be part of the solution - and help fix this problem.

 

REMEMBER: If the Website does not suit your needs, you can call (424) 348-HELI (4354) and follow the prompts to provide specific information on the helicopter noise complaint. The menu selection has been developed to structure the disturbance report so that all efforts can be made to better identify the aviation activities being reported. The information provided by callers will be included in the countywide complaint data; however complaints filed on the website will include the most comprehensive and accurate information.
